Windows篇
搭建Android开发环境需要安装JAVA的SDK(也就是JDK),Android SDK,Android 工具包ADT(一些老教材中有提到,在Android Studio中已经具备),还有Android集成工具(Android Studio或者Eclipse)。
众所周知,谷歌一直跟大陆关系没谈好,所以android的官网android.com没发正常访问上,身为android开发人员必不可少一个代理让你访问到官网,不过,就算你很穷不舍得花钱买个vpn也没用关系,互联网好就好在共享资源,可以到各大搜索引擎到android的相关资料。推荐一个包揽各个版本的地址androiddevtools.cn,在这里可以下载各个版本的Android Studio。
安装JDK
1.浏览器访问JDK下载地址。
点击jdk的download后,同意是协议并下载对应自己的电脑的版本,比如我的电脑是32位的系统,则点击x86.exe就可以下载了。
下载完毕后,双击exe文件安装,安装路径,我们选择在非C盘(别给驱动盘添加负担),比如我选择在E:/java目录下。注意路径不要带有空格或者中文。
配置环境变量
为什么要配置环境变量?
在实际开发中,我们可能需要在终端中输入一些命令来构建或者打包程序,也有一些构件工具需要以来这些环境变量来完成构建。所以配置环境是养好编程习惯的基础。
- win7以上
右击“计算机”,找到“属性”->找到“高级系统设置”
点击“环境变量”
看到“系统环境变量”,点击“新建”。
变量名为:JAVA_HOME
变量值为:刚刚我们安装的JDK的安装路径,比如E:/java
点击“确定”保存后,找到系统环境变量里面有一个叫PATH的变量,点击“编辑”,在变量值的最后面加上分号“;”并且输入
%JAVA_HOME%/bin;
注意:在windows下path路径的值都是以分号“;”隔开
全部设置为完毕,点击确定。
来检查一下,打开终端(cmd.exe),输入
java -version
如果有输出java的版本信息,则jdk的环境变量配置成功。
- win7以下
右击“我的电脑”,找到“属性”->“高级”->“环境变量”,后面步骤类同win7以上的方法。
安装Android SDK
安装android sdk并没有安装jdk那么麻烦,只要解压就可以了。同样解压的完了我们要把这个文件夹放在何时的位置,依然是最好不要带有空格和中文字符的路径。
官网的下载地址:,如果你不想现在下载也没有关系,后面安装Android Stuido的时候如果没有检测到Android SDK会进行自动下载(有时候需要翻墙)。
如果没有vpn那么在本章提到的androiddevtools.cn中可以找到android sdk的下载。
类同安装JDK的方法,我们还要给Android SDK配置环境变量
ANDROID_HOME : Android SDK 解压后的路径
PATH: 在PATH路径上击加上 %ANDROID_HOME%/tools;%ANDROID_HOME%/platform-tools;
在终端输入
adb shell
检查android环境变量是否配置成功。
安装Andorid Stuido
在官网或者androiddevtools.cn下载最新版本的Android Studio(for windows),安装/解压就可以使用了。
首次打开会比较慢,因为它需要上官网检查一下SDK的情况,没有vpn的人到了这里就会一直卡住永远进不去,这里我们需要修改一下Android Studio的配置。
1)进入刚安装的Android Studio目录下的bin目录。找到idea.properties文件,用文本编辑器打开。
2)在idea.properties文件末尾添加一行: disable.android.first.run=true ,然后保存文件。
3)关闭Android Studio后重新启动,便可进入界面。
如果提示找不到Android SDK的位置,这个时候我们需要设定一下之前安放Android SDK的位置。如果这个时候没有设置成功也没有关系,我们还可以修改它的位置.
打开Android Studio选择“Configure”->“Product Defaults”->“Product Structure”
在Android SDK Location中设置它的位置。也有可能会出现找不到JDK的情况,也需要手动设置一下路径就可以了。